BHPBill prices bonds
BHPBill has priced a two tranche euro bond and a two tranche sterling bond under its Euro Medium Term Note Programme. The euro bond issue comprises EUR1,250 million 2.250% bonds due 2020 and EUR750 million 3.250% bonds due 2027. The sterling bond issue comprises GBP750 million 3.250% bonds due 2024 and GBP1 000 million 4.300% bonds due 2042. The proceeds will be used for general corporate purposes and in part, redemption of the group's commercial paper programme.

BHPBill -- dividend currency exchange rates
On 22 August 2012 BHPBill declared a final dividend for the year ended 30 June 2012 of 57 US cents per share. Included in the announcement was the advice that the currency conversion for Australian cents, British pence and New Zealand cents would be based on the foreign currency exchange rates on the Record Date, 7 September 2012, and for South African cents the last date to trade on the JSE Limited, which was 31 August 2012. The following details the currency exchange rates applicable for the dividend:
Dividend 57 US cps
- Australian cents: 1.034794 (exchange rate) = 55.083427 (in local currency)
- British pence :1.596447 (exchange rate) = 35.704286 (in local currency)
- New Zealand cents :0.804743 (exchange rate) = 70.830066 (in local currency)
- South African cents): 8.441200 (exchange rate) = 481.148400 (in local currency)
The dividend will be paid on 28 September 2012.

BHPBill sells RBM stake for USD1.91 billion
BHPBill has completed the sale of its 37 per cent non-operated interest in Richards Bay Minerals (RBM) to Rio Tinto. As part of the restructuring of RBM in 2009, BHPBill and Rio Tinto concluded an option agreement that made provision for BHPBill to sell its interest in RBM to Rio Tinto pursuant to an agreed valuation process. BHPBill and Rio Tinto announced on 1 February 2012 that this option had been exercised and that completion of the transaction was conditional upon the fulfilment of customary regulatory approvals, all of which have now been met.
Pursuant to the prescribed valuation process, BHPBill has sold its entire interest in RBM for USD1.91 billion before adjustments. The divestment reflects the company's commitment to a simpler, more scalable upstream portfolio. RBM is a South African mineral sands mining and smelting operation and the leading producer of chloride titanium dioxide feedstock. Prior to completion of the sale, BHPBill held a 37 per cent equity stake in RBM with equity partners Rio Tinto (37 per cent), Black Economic Empowerment (BEE) parties (24 per cent) and employees (2 per cent).
